Shui Chuen O is located in Sha Tin, with a height of 372 meters. There are open and wide views along the trail from Ngau Pei Shan Village to Shui Chuen O, but no official hiking trail is provided for Shui Chuen O, the paths to Shui Chuen O are rugged with dense grasses and scrubs and steep inclination, suggested to walk accompanied with experienced hikers.
